Saalbach, Österreich - Matthias Mayer, the three-time Olympic champion in the ski alpine, announced his return to the ski world with an exciting announcement! After his surprising resignation during the races in Bormio 2022, when he revealed sudden health problems, the Carinthian is now planning to start as a forerunner at the 2025 skiing championship in Saalbach. In a conversation with Today he said that he was already in training to cope with the World Cup route. This decision is the first step towards integration into competition, but without the printing of an official racing start.
Mayer is aware of the challenges that he has had to cope with in recent years, including mental burdens that led to his resignation. He describes the past few months as a learning process that has helped him gain distance from the competitive pressure. This new approach is also evident in its goals for the future: "First of all, I want to drive as a forerunner," says Mayer in Skiweltcup.tv . In addition, he plans to start as a forerunner at European Cacu races in Zauchensee and on the Reiteralm, which heats up the rumor about a comeback in the World Cup. In any case, the door for a possible return to the world tip is still open, especially since Mayer could benefit from the wildcard control.
However, his focus is on a relaxed return: "I want to measure myself with the mountain and not with other drivers," emphasizes Mayer. At the same time, as a test driver, he supports his former sponsors and thus remains loyal to the ski circus.
